Jordan Traas delivered a masterful performance at New Hampshire Motor Speedway, advancing from his third-place starting position to claim victory in the ATC Xfinity Series Round 11 and seize the championship lead with just four races remaining. The #79 driver executed a clean race with zero incidents across the 100-lap distance, maximizing his 42-point haul while former points leader Mitchell Williams struggled to an eighth-place finish after starting second. Traas now holds a slim four-point advantage over Williams in the title fight, turning what was an eight-point deficit into a crucial lead heading into the final stretch of the season.
David Burcicki emerged as the race's hard charger, slicing through the field from seventh to second place despite accumulating two incidents during his charge to the runner-up position. The #92 driver's five-position gain earned him 36 points and a valuable podium finish, while Kyle Byrd rounded out the top three after moving up one spot from his fourth-place starting position. Dan Smith also gained a position from fifth to fourth, collecting 33 points to vault into fifth place in the championship standings.
The race proved costly for several championship contenders, most notably pole-sitter Justin Frazier, who tumbled from first to ninth after accumulating 10 incidents throughout the event. Despite the disappointing result, Frazier managed to add 28 points and maintain third in the championship standings, though he now trails Traas by 50 points. Mitchell Williams' title defense took a significant hit as the #54 driver fell six positions from second to eighth, his five incidents contributing to a day that saw him surrender the points lead he had held entering the weekend at New Hampshire.
